Author David Reid Discusses Late 1940s New York (3/3)
Perhaps no other city has influenced the culture of the entire country quite like New York. In his book "The Brazen Age: New York City and the American Empire: Politics, Art, and Bohemia," David Reid writes about the city’s important figures, culture, and political climate during the period between 1945-1950. Rafael Pi Roman speaks with Reid about this fascinating period in NYC history.
